From 3e23bb62362e11052c98cdd67dba9b2d65938255 Mon Sep 17 00:00:00 2001 From: rudolfkoenig <> Date: Wed, 14 Nov 2018 08:29:31 +0000 Subject: [PATCH] 00_MQTT2_SERVER.pm: add more details to keepalive farewell (Forum #93205) git-svn-id: https://svn.fhem.de/fhem/trunk/fhem@17745 2b470e98-0d58-463d-a4d8-8e2adae1ed80 --- FHEM/00_MQTT2_SERVER.pm |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/FHEM/00_MQTT2_SERVER.pm b/FHEM/00_MQTT2_SERVER.pm index 86cfa624e..2de6f7da6 100644 --- a/FHEM/00_MQTT2_SERVER.pm +++ b/FHEM/00_MQTT2_SERVER.pm @@ -40,6 +40,7 @@ MQTT2_SERVER_Initialize($) autocreate disable:0,1 disabledForIntervals + keepaliveFactor rawEvents sslVersion sslCertPrefix @@ -83,7 +84,9 @@ MQTT2_SERVER_keepaliveChecker($) my $cHash = $defs{$clName}; next if(!$cHash || !$cHash->{keepalive} || $now < $cHash->{lastMsgTime}+$cHash->{keepalive}*$multiplier ); - Log3 $hash, 3, "$hash->{NAME}: $clName left us (keepalive check)"; + my $msgName = $clName; + $msgName .= "/".$cHash->{cid} if($cHash->{cid}); + Log3 $hash, 3, "$hash->{NAME}: $msgName left us (keepalive check)"; CommandDelete(undef, $clName); } }